Understanding Arthritis: Types and Causes
Arthritis is not a single disease but a complex group of diseases. It is primarily classified into several types, each with distinctive causes and characteristics:
-
Osteoarthritis (OA):
- Description: This is the most common form of arthritis, characterized by the degeneration of cartilage, the smooth protective tissue in joints.
- Causes: Aging, joint injury, and genetic predisposition contribute to OA.
-
Rheumatoid Arthritis (RA):
- Description: An autoimmune disorder that causes the body's immune system to attack its own joint tissues.
- Causes: Autoimmune response, genetic factors, and environmental triggers.
-
Psoriatic Arthritis:
- Description: Affects some people with psoriasis, leading to joint inflammation and associated skin symptoms.
- Causes: Similar autoimmune origins as RA, often related to psoriasis.
-
Gout:
- Description: A type of inflammatory arthritis that occurs when uric acid crystals accumulate in joints.
- Causes: Excessive uric acid due to diet, genetics, and inefficient kidney excretion.
-
Juvenile Arthritis:
- Description: Affects children, leading to chronic joint inflammation.
- Causes: Autoimmune factors are predominantly suspected.
Understanding these different forms of arthritis is crucial in assessing their potential for a cure, as the mechanisms and treatment options can vary significantly.
Current Treatment Options for Arthritis
While a definitive cure for arthritis remains elusive, there are numerous effective treatments available that aim to control symptoms, maintain joint function, and improve quality of life. Treatment strategies can be grouped into several categories:
-
Pharmacological Treatments:
- Nonsteroidal Anti-Inflammatory Drugs (NSAIDs): Reduce inflammation and relieve pain.
- Disease-Modifying Antirheumatic Drugs (DMARDs): Slow disease progression, especially in RA.
- Biologic Agents: Target specific parts of the immune system to reduce inflammation, used in autoimmune types like RA and psoriatic arthritis.
- Corticosteroids: Fast-acting anti-inflammatory drugs used to control severe flare-ups.
-
Non-Pharmacological Treatments:
- Physical Therapy: Strengthens muscles around joints and improves mobility.
- Occupational Therapy: Assists in adjusting daily routines to minimize strain on joints.
- Weight Management: Helps reduce stress on weight-bearing joints, particularly beneficial for OA.
- Assistive Devices: Canes or braces to support and protect joints.
-
Surgical Interventions:
- Arthroscopy: Minimally invasive surgery to repair joint damage.
- Joint Replacement Surgery: Replaces damaged joint with artificial implants, commonly used for severe OA.
-
Lifestyle and Home Remedies:
- Exercise: Low-impact activities like swimming and walking improve joint flexibility and strength.
- Diet: Anti-inflammatory diets, including foods rich in omega-3 fatty acids, may help reduce symptoms.
Through a combination of these treatments, many individuals with arthritis achieve significant symptom relief and improved quality of life. However, it's important to personalize treatment, working closely with healthcare providers to address specific needs.
Research and Future Prospects: Pathways to a Cure
The scientific and medical communities are actively researching potential cures and breakthroughs for arthritis. Several promising avenues are under exploration:
-
Gene Therapy:
- The goal is to correct or modify genes responsible for arthritis. Researchers are investigating gene-editing technologies like CRISPR to potentially alter disease-causing genes in arthritis patients.
-
Stem Cell Therapy:
- Utilizes the body's own cells to repair and regenerate damaged joint tissues. This approach is especially promising for osteoarthritis, where cartilage regeneration is the main focus.
-
Immunotherapy:
- In efforts to better manage autoimmune arthritis types, researchers are developing therapies that modulate the immune system to reduce inflammation without compromising overall immunity.
-
Biomarkers and Personalized Medicine:
- Identifying specific biomarkers can lead to early diagnosis and personalized treatment strategies, helping to tailor therapies based on individual genetic makeup.
-
Innovative Drug Research:
- New drug formulations and delivery methods, including nanoparticles and biologics, aim to offer more targeted and effective relief with fewer side effects.
While these innovations hold potential, their development is in various stages, ranging from exploratory research to clinical trials. The complexity of arthritis poses a challenge, but advancements continue to provide hope for improved long-term outcomes.
Addressing Common Questions and Misconceptions
-
Can lifestyle changes alone cure arthritis?
- While lifestyle changes like diet and exercise can significantly improve symptoms and joint function, they cannot cure arthritis. They are vital components of a comprehensive management plan.
-
Is surgery the only option for severe arthritis?
- Surgery, such as joint replacement, is not the only option and is reserved for severe cases where other treatments have failed. Non-surgical approaches should always be exhausted first.
-
Do all forms of arthritis have the same treatments?
- Not all forms of arthritis respond to the same treatments. For example, RA requires immunosuppressive therapy, while gout may be managed effectively with dietary changes and urate-lowering drugs.
